A year long community fitness challenge raising funds for the Mental Health Foundation of New Zealand.
Waikato
In 2026, we're committing to move our bodies regularly - not for medals or personal bests, but to support better mental health across Aotearoa.
This is a community challenge built around inclusion and consistency. Participants choose activities that work for them:
- Gym/strength training
- Running/walking
- Swimming/biking
Every session, kilometres, and effort contributes towards shared community goals.
Mental health affects every family, workplace, and community in New Zealand. By moving together over 12 months, we're raising funds and awareness for the Mental Health Foundation NZ, helping ensure more people can access support, education, and resources.
We have chosen to do this over a 12 month period, not because we wanted a long time to get donations, but because we see Mental health as something that takes time to work on. We will see 4 seasons over the year as well as ups and downs in work, family and friends which impact us in many different ways.
Yearly goal for movement across NZ is:
• 🏋️ 1,500 gym sessions
• 🏃 3,000 km run / walk
• 🏊 300 km swimming OR 🚴 6,000 km cycling
3 Tiers to choose from:
Bronze (Beginner)
• 2 gym sessions/week
• 10–15 km run/walk per month
• Swim 1 km or Bike 20 km per month
Silver (Regular)
• 3 gym sessions/week
• 25–35 km run/month
• Swim 2–3 km or Bike 40–60 km
Gold (Committed)
• 4 gym sessions/week
• 40+ km run/month
• Swim 4+ km or Bike 80+
